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Update plugin-bom.version to v3435 (major) #2568

Merged
merged 2 commits into from
Oct 7, 2024

Conversation

renovate[bot]
Copy link
Contributor

@renovate renovate bot commented Sep 30, 2024

This PR contains the following updates:

Package Change Age Adoption Passing Confidence
io.jenkins.tools.bom:bom-2.440.x (source) 3387.v0f2773fa_3200 -> 3435.v238d66a_043fb_ age adoption passing confidence
io.jenkins.tools.bom:bom-2.452.x (source) 3387.v0f2773fa_3200 -> 3435.v238d66a_043fb_ age adoption passing confidence

Release Notes

jenkinsci/bom (io.jenkins.tools.bom:bom-2.440.x)

v3435.v238d66a_043fb_

Compare Source

🐛 Bug fixes
📦 Dependency updates
  • Bump org.jenkins-ci.plugins:plugin from 4.88 to 5.0 in /sample-plugin (#​3675) @​dependabot
  • Bump org.jenkins-ci.plugins:junit from 1302.va_b_878c32eb_b_5 to 1303.v05e2505656b_7 in /bom-weekly (#​3674) @​dependabot
  • Bump org.jenkins-ci.plugins:active-directory from 2.36 to 2.37 in /bom-weekly (#​3670) @​dependabot
  • Bump mina-sshd-api.version from 2.13.2-125.v200281b_61d59 to 2.14.0-131.v04e9b_6b_e0362 in /bom-weekly (#​3668) @​dependabot
  • Bump org.jenkins-ci.plugins.workflow:workflow-job from 1436.vfa_244484591f to 1441.vb_2d416905b_35 in /bom-weekly (#​3666) @​dependabot
  • Update dependency org.jenkins-ci.main:jenkins-war to v2.479 (#​3665) @​renovate
  • Bump org.jenkins-ci.plugins:credentials from 1380.va_435002fa_924 to 1381.v2c3a_12074da_b_ in /bom-weekly (#​3664) @​dependabot
  • Bump pipeline-maven-plugin.version from 1421.v610fa_b_e2d60e to 1457.vf7a_de13b_c0d4 in /bom-weekly (#​3661) @​dependabot
  • Bump org.jenkins-ci.plugins:oic-auth from 4.354.v321ce67a_1de8 to 4.355.v3a_fb_fca_b_96d4 in /bom-weekly (#​3662) @​dependabot
  • Bump org.jenkins-ci.plugins:ldap from 756.v2f20b_801f120 to 759.vef7f616475df in /bom-weekly (#​3663) @​dependabot
  • Bump org.jenkins-ci.plugins:ldap from 753.v387f5b_3ea_8d0 to 756.v2f20b_801f120 in /bom-weekly (#​3660) @​dependabot
  • Bump org.jenkins-ci.plugins:credentials from 1378.v81ef4269d764 to 1380.va_435002fa_924 in /bom-weekly (#​3656) @​dependabot
  • Bump org.jenkins-ci.plugins:build-user-vars-plugin from 178.v69708a_7a_dc17 to 182.v378b_9f14b_487 in /bom-weekly (#​3655) @​dependabot
  • Bump org.jenkins-ci.plugins:matrix-project from 832.va_66e270d2946 to 838.v4d7b_7b_f9b_d4b_ in /bom-weekly (#​3654) @​dependabot
  • Bump org.jenkins-ci.modules:instance-identity from 185.v303dc7c645f9 to 201.vd2a_b_5a_468a_a_6 in /bom-weekly (#​3650) @​dependabot
  • Bump org.jenkins-ci.plugins:resource-disposer from 0.23 to 0.24 in /bom-weekly (#​3649) @​dependabot
  • Bump org.jenkins-ci.plugins:database-sqlite from 1.7 to 1.8 in /bom-weekly (#​3648) @​dependabot
  • Bump org.jenkins-ci.plugins:ldap from 733.vd3700c27b_043 to 753.v387f5b_3ea_8d0 in /bom-weekly (#​3647) @​dependabot
  • Bump io.jenkins.plugins:byte-buddy-api from 1.15.1-59.v81e90f37c4c6 to 1.15.3-65.vdef5c3465747 in /bom-weekly (#​3646) @​dependabot
  • Bump io.jenkins.plugins:oss-symbols-api from 71.v08d42ee3785d to 75.v337a_1c270ffc in /bom-weekly (#​3645) @​dependabot
  • Bump org.jenkins-ci.plugins:mailer from 472.vf7c289a_4b_420 to 488.v0c9639c1a_eb_3 in /bom-weekly (#​3644) @​dependabot

v3413.v0d896b_76a_30d

Compare Source

🚀 New features and improvements
👻 Maintenance
📦 Dependency updates
  • Bump org.jenkins-ci.plugins:cloudbees-folder from 6.951.v5f91d88d76b_b_ to 6.955.v81e2a_35c08d3 in /bom-weekly (#​3642) @​dependabot
  • Bump org.jenkins-ci.plugins.workflow:workflow-cps from 3964.v0767b_4b_a_0b_fa_ to 3969.vdc9d3a_efcc6a_ in /bom-weekly (#​3641) @​dependabot
  • Bump org.jenkins-ci.plugins:junit from 1300.v03d9d8a_cf1fb_ to 1302.va_b_878c32eb_b_5 in /bom-weekly (#​3638) @​dependabot
  • Bump io.jenkins.plugins:flyway-api from 10.18.1-161.v8cc01e08c2c0 to 10.18.2-163.v10696ed45dd6 in /bom-weekly (#​3639) @​dependabot
  • Bump io.jenkins.plugins:pipeline-graph-view from 348.vdb_a_dd48d7c11 to 349.veda_b_e2366d99 in /bom-weekly (#​3636) @​dependabot
  • Bump io.jenkins.plugins:pipeline-graph-view from 340.v28cecee8b_25f to 348.vdb_a_dd48d7c11 in /bom-weekly (#​3631) @​dependabot
  • Bump io.jenkins.plugins:flyway-api from 10.18.0-155.ve2f66ff5742e to 10.18.1-161.v8cc01e08c2c0 in /bom-weekly (#​3633) @​dependabot
  • Bump org.6wind.jenkins:lockable-resources from 1310.v99ca_947ed698 to 1315.v4ea_8e5159ec8 in /bom-weekly (#​3632) @​dependabot
  • Bump org.jenkins-ci.plugins:docker-java-api from 3.3.6-90.ve7c5c7535ddd to 3.4.0-94.v65ced49b_a_7d5 in /bom-weekly (#​3630) @​dependabot
  • Update dependency org.jenkins-ci.main:jenkins-war to v2.478 (#​3629) @​renovate
  • Bump org.jenkins-ci.plugins:credentials from 1371.vfee6b_095f0a_3 to 1378.v81ef4269d764 in /bom-weekly (#​3590) @​dependabot
  • Bump org.csanchez.jenkins.plugins:kubernetes from 4288.v1719f9d0c854 to 4290.v93ea_4b_b_26a_61 in /bom-weekly (#​3625) @​dependabot
  • Bump org.jenkins-ci.plugins:support-core from 1504.va_1d6d0e4d653 to 1511.v3f5cc9b_a_ff55 in /bom-weekly (#​3624) @​dependabot
  • Bump org.jenkins-ci.plugins:plugin from 4.87 to 4.88 in /sample-plugin (#​3623) @​dependabot
  • Bump org.jenkins-ci:jenkins from 1.122 to 1.123 in /bom-weekly (#​3622) @​dependabot
  • Bump org.jenkins-ci.plugins:database from 247.v244b_d85f086d to 266.v1d03c767934e in /bom-weekly (#​3615) @​dependabot
  • Bump io.jenkins.plugins:markdown-formatter from 220.v1a_262cd9f77f to 225.v859f46dea_3b_5 in /bom-weekly (#​3616) @​dependabot
  • Bump io.jenkins.plugins:warnings-ng from 11.5.0 to 11.7.0 in /bom-weekly (#​3609) @​dependabot
  • Bump io.jenkins.plugins:plugin-util-api from 4.1.0 to 5.1.0 in /bom-weekly (#​3610) @​dependabot
  • Bump io.jenkins.plugins:analysis-model-api from 12.4.0 to 12.7.0 in /bom-weekly (#​3611) @​dependabot
  • Bump org.jenkins-ci.plugins:oic-auth from 4.350.v347c3b_8b_9d95 to 4.354.v321ce67a_1de8 in /bom-weekly (#​3612) @​dependabot

Configuration

📅 Schedule: Branch creation - "before 4am on Monday" (UTC), Automerge - At any time (no schedule defined).

🚦 Automerge: Enabled.

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about these updates again.


  • If you want to rebase/retry this PR, check this box

This PR was generated by Mend Renovate. View the repository job log.

@renovate renovate bot requested a review from a team as a code owner September 30, 2024 03:27
@renovate renovate bot added the dependencies A PR that updates dependencies - used by Release Drafter label Sep 30, 2024
@renovate renovate bot enabled auto-merge (rebase) September 30, 2024 03:27
@renovate renovate bot force-pushed the renovate/major-plugin-bom.version branch from d860e2c to 16213b6 Compare October 4, 2024 13:48
@renovate renovate bot changed the title Update plugin-bom.version to v3413 (major) Update plugin-bom.version to v3435 (major) Oct 4, 2024
@MarkEWaite
Copy link
Contributor

The credentials plugin now throws an exception from a method that previously did not throw an exception. The tests need to be adapted to that change. The change looks like this:

diff --git a/integrations/src/test/java/io/jenkins/plugins/casc/CredentialsTest.java b/integrations/src/test/java/io/jenkins/plugins/casc/CredentialsTest.java
index 9a2ce882..34aed3d9 100644
--- a/integrations/src/test/java/io/jenkins/plugins/casc/CredentialsTest.java
+++ b/integrations/src/test/java/io/jenkins/plugins/casc/CredentialsTest.java
@@ -37,7 +37,7 @@ public class CredentialsTest {

     @ConfiguredWithCode("GlobalCredentials.yml")
     @Test
-    public void testGlobalScopedCredentials() {
+    public void testGlobalScopedCredentials() throws Exception {
         List<StandardUsernamePasswordCredentials> creds = CredentialsProvider.lookupCredentials(
                 StandardUsernamePasswordCredentials.class, Jenkins.getInstanceOrNull(), null, Collections.emptyList());
         assertThat(creds.size(), is(1));
@@ -60,7 +60,7 @@ public class CredentialsTest {

     @ConfiguredWithCode("CredentialsWithDomain.yml")
     @Test
-    public void testDomainScopedCredentials() {
+    public void testDomainScopedCredentials() throws Exception {
         List<StandardUsernamePasswordCredentials> creds = CredentialsProvider.lookupCredentials(
                 StandardUsernamePasswordCredentials.class, Jenkins.getInstanceOrNull(), null, Collections.emptyList());
         assertThat(creds.size(), is(1));
@@ -149,7 +149,7 @@ public class CredentialsTest {

     @Test
     @Issue("SECURITY-1404")
-    public void checkUsernamePasswordIsSecret() {
+    public void checkUsernamePasswordIsSecret() throws Exception {
         Attribute a = getFromDatabound(UsernamePasswordCredentialsImpl.class, "password");
         assertTrue(
                 "Attribute 'password' should be secret",

@renovate renovate bot force-pushed the renovate/major-plugin-bom.version branch from 16213b6 to cf01418 Compare October 7, 2024 22:56
@basil basil disabled auto-merge October 7, 2024 22:59
@basil basil enabled auto-merge (squash) October 7, 2024 22:59
@basil basil merged commit c5f43ed into master Oct 7, 2024
18 of 19 checks passed
@basil basil deleted the renovate/major-plugin-bom.version branch October 7, 2024 23: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
dependencies A PR that updates dependencies - used by Release Drafter
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ants